Maa Ganga is not approached for a particular outcome so much as for cleansing — of what has accumulated, of what was done knowingly and unknowingly. The snan-sankalp taken at a ghat, the deep-daan floated on her waters, and the aarti offered at dusk are her sevas.
Divyachadhava performs these at Har Ki Paudi in Haridwar, where Ganga first touches the plains, and at Dashashwamedh Ghat in Kashi. Your naam-gotra is spoken at the ghat before the offering is made.
